Please don't jump to the conclusion that Different = Rare. If you mean that your coin has part of the image of another nickel struck on it, it could be a mint error called a double strike. That happens when a coin blank doesn't slide out of the press in time and is struck again when the press comes down for the next coin. That might be worth a few dollars. However, if there's some kind of special image or wording or other inscription that isn't on all the other nickels in your pocket, you have a novelty item made by a private company. These companies take regular coins (usually cents, but sometimes nickels or quarters) and stamp special symbols on them - a Liberty bell, a picture of JFK, etc., and sell them at inflated prices as "collectibles". Problem is, there's very little aftermarket demand, so whatever you buy is worth little more than face value. To a strict coin collector, these are considered to be altered pieces and have no extra value.
In order to reach consumers all across the nation, many world manufacturers work through manufacturers representatives or agents. Reps or agents refer to independent businesses that sometimes form the distribution channels through which manufacturers' products are disseminated to reach chain buyers. Manufacturers representatives, such as Ron Buff, owner and president of Buff Sales, play a very important role in moving the manufacturers' line of products to retail shelves. Manufacturers reps are important in today's overly competitive marketplace for a number of reasons. For starters, reps serve manufacturers by carrying out the planning and sales for their businesses. They help select the best choices from the many products manufacturers produce. And lastly, they help manufacturers' products disseminate over a larger geographical region.

Aftermarket parts allow auto enthusiasts to do all kinds of customizations to their cars. People use aftermarket parts to enhance the performance or appearance of their cars or replace old parts. You can find a wide range of aftermarket car parts for vehicles of almost all makes and models on the road. Many car enthusiasts install aftermarket parts in their cars themselves, while others have them installed by professionals. For a lot of people, installing aftermarket parts is a hobby.
